Job description

Description

Our organization in Amazon Robotics builds robots that perform contact-rich manipulation safely and reliably in complex, unstructured environments at Amazon scale. Our scientists and engineers push the boundaries of robotic manipulation to handle unparalleled object diversity, bringing deep expertise across planning, control, perception, and machine learning. We learn from real-world data at a scale that few teams in robotics can access.

We are seeking an Applied Scientist to advance reinforcement learning for manipulation. We are creating robots that learn how to push, flip, rearrange, and dexterously insert items with unparalleled robustness, speed, and reliability. Our goal is to deploy robots that will work across Amazon's global network and can handle the full diversity of items that Amazon sells. You will focus on training these policies in simulation at scale and transferring them to physical robots. You will join a small team whose mission reaches beyond any single product: to invent and apply manipulation capabilities that generalize to many future robotics applications. The robots our organization already deploys at scale give you a rare proving ground to collect data, run experiments, and get new policies onto real hardware faster than almost anywhere in the field.

Key job responsibilities
  • Design and train reinforcement learning policies for non-prehensile and contact-rich manipulation, focused on the long tail of diverse, demanding conditions.
  • Build and scale simulation environments, training curricula, and reward formulations that produce policies which transfer to real robots.
  • Develop sim-to-real methods (domain randomization, system identification, and related techniques) and validate them on physical hardware.
  • Write production-quality code and own scalable, efficient training and evaluation pipelines.
  • Evaluate policy behavior and failure modes, and iterate between simulation and real‑world testing to improve robustness.
  • Partner with scientists and engineers across control, perception, and hardware to move ideas from prototype to demonstrated capability.
  • Represent Amazon Robotics in academia through publications and scientific presentations.
